Glen Island Park
- Weyman Ave, New Rochelle, NY 10805
- (914) 654-2300
Located on its own island, Glen Island Park offers scenic waterfront views for groups of all types to enjoy, making it one of New Rochelle’s most popular destinations, and for good reason. Take a stroll down the beach, rent a kayak or paddle boat, pack a picnic lunch or dinner to enjoy, or simply sunbathe while gazing at the Long Island Sound. If you’re headed here for a sporting event, play basketball or volleyball on the public courts. Or, if you’re looking for something educational, visit the museum and ruins of Glen Island Casino, which, as a historic nightclub and vaudeville theater, served as one of the first locations in the country where big band jazz developed and grew to become America’s favorite type of music in the 1930s.

Thomas Paine Cottage
- 20 Sicard Ave, New Rochelle, NY 10801
- (914) 632-5376
This small, one-story home is more than just a museum. It’s a monument to the author and activist Thomas Paine, one of the United States’ Founding Fathers. You can learn about Paine’s life and work by walking through the restored home.

Wildcliff Manor House
- 4 Wildcliff Rd, New Rochelle, NY 10805
- (914) 633-2100
Are you looking for a scenic place to spend a sunny afternoon? This location houses a museum dedicated to the Arts and Crafts Movement of the 1920s and 30s, featuring the works of New Rochelle artisans including stained glass artists and glassmakers.

Downtown
Downtown New Rochelle is home to the Thomas Paine Cottage and the New Rochelle Public Library, two of the city’s most visited attractions. Walk along tree-lined walkways, peruse the boutiques and cafes, and enjoy delicious meals at any of the variety of restaurants. If your group of friends or family wants to get out of the city for a while, the New Rochelle train station is in the heart of Downtown with easy access to Grand Central Terminal and the rest of New York City.

Wykagyl
Known as the oldest neighborhood in the city, Wykagyl sits north of Downtown and is where you’ll find some of New Rochelle’s most historic churches and homes, including the Christ Church and the Wykagyl Country Club.

Beechmont Woods
The Beechmont neighborhood stretches from Davenport Park near the bay in the north through Barnard School and Daniel Webster Elementary School and down to Downtown. Here you’ll find the historic St Gabriel’s church, as well as a variety of shops along North Avenue.
